Be Smart - Don't Start (Smoking)
Sign in to track this film in your collection or want list.
Duration: 14
Genre: Educational
Creator: Films / West
Format: 16mm
Sound: sound
Description: Discusses the hazards of smoking, which includes inhalation of poisonous nicotine and tar. Explains that smoking can eventually impair breathing and cause heart disease, lung cancer and emphysema. Concludes with testimonial statements from teenagers who decided to quit., Shows the physiological effect of tobacco smoke on the human body. Designed to help young people create a life-time mental attitude against smoking.
